UFC Star Ngannou Involved in Fatal Accident in Cameroon

Former UFC heavyweight champion and current PFL fighter Francis Ngannou was involved in a deadly traffic accident in Cameroon, as reported by Le Bled Parle.

According to reports, 17-year-old Ntsama Brigitte Manuella died after being struck by a motorcycle driven by Ngannou. The accident happened while Manuella was returning home from a walk with friends.

The collision was severe, and Ngannou immediately rushed to help, personally transporting her to a hospital in Yaoundé known for its advanced medical facilities. Despite undergoing emergency surgery for serious injuries to her leg and arm, Manuella did not survive.

Ngannou last fought in October 2024 at the PFL Super Fights - Battle of the Giants, where he won against Renan Ferreira by knockout in the first round. His professional record currently stands at 18 wins and three losses.
